.msg-window-wrap{width:345px;height:170px;display:block;position:absolute;text-align:center;overflow:hidden;}
/*header*/
.msg-window-header{width:100%;height:21px;}
.msg-window-header-left, .msg-window-header-right{width:6px;height:21px;float:left;background: url(//earn.yystatic.com/earn/images/bg-msg/bg-window-leftcorners.gif) no-repeat 0 0;}
.msg-window-header-right{background: url(//earn.yystatic.com/earn/images/bg-msg/bg-window-rightcorners.gif) no-repeat 0 0;float:right;}
.msg-window-header-content{width:333px;height:21px;background: url(//earn.yystatic.com/earn/images/bg-msg/bg-window-topbottom.gif) repeat-x top;float:left;}
.msg-window-header-content span{text-size:left;font-weight:bold;line-height:21px;float:left;}

.btn-msg-window-close-noraml, .btn-msg-window-close-over{width:19px;height:20px;position:absolute;right:5px;top:-1px;display:block;cursor:pointer;background: url(//web.yystatic.com/project/noble/pc/img/ico-msg/ico-msg-window-close.gif) no-repeat 0 2px;}
.btn-msg-window-close-over{background: url(//web.yystatic.com/project/noble/pc/img/ico-msg/ico-msg-window-close.gif) no-repeat -19px 2px;} 

/*content*/
.msg-window-container{width:100%;background-color:#f2f2f2;overflow:hidden;text-align:center;display:block;}
.msg-window-body-left, .msg-window-body-right, .msg-window-body-center{height:139px;}
.msg-window-body-left{width:6px;background: url(//earn.yystatic.com/earn/images/bg-msg/bg-window-leftright.gif) repeat-y 0 0;float:left;}
.msg-window-body-right{width:6px;background: url(//earn.yystatic.com/earn/images/bg-msg/bg-window-leftright.gif) repeat-y -6px 0;float:right;}
.msg-window-body-center{width:333px;float:left;}
.msg-window-msg-content{width:328px;height:auto;margin-top:0px; margin-right:10px;overflow-y:hidden;overflow-x:hidden;}
.msg-window-msg-content p{ font-size:12px;}
.msg-window-msg-content .tips{ color:#999;}
.msg-window-msg-content table {float:left; margin:0; width:auto;}
.msg-window-msg-content table td{height:60px;text-align:left; line-height:20px;}

/*maessage icon*/
.msg-window-ico-error{background: url(//web.yystatic.com/project/noble/pc/img/ico-msg/ico-error.gif?v=20120531) no-repeat center center;}
.msg-window-ico-success{background: url(//web.yystatic.com/project/noble/pc/img/ico-msg/ico-success.gif?v=20120531) no-repeat center center;}
.msg-window-ico-warning{background: url(//web2.yystatic.com/project/noble/pc/img/ico-msg/ico-warning.gif?v=20120531) no-repeat center center;}

/*button*/
.mid_con{ width:398px;border-left:1px #919496 solid; border-right:1px #919496 solid; background:#f7fafd; padding:10px 0;}
.msg-window-button {display:block;text-align:right;background:#F0F5F8 url(//web.yystatic.com/project/noble/pc/img/entertain/pop_bottom_bg.gif?v=20120531) no-repeat; width:385px; padding:6px 15px 0 0; height:32px;border-top:1px solid #9ABED8;}
.msg-window-button div{display:inline-block; margin-right:15px; *position:relative;*float:left;*left:30%;}

/*.msg-window-button div input{width:16px;height:16px;border:0;vertical-align:middle;margin-right:5px;cursor:pointer;}*/
/*button icon*/
/*.ico-btn-order-ok{background: url(//web2.yystatic.com/project/noble/pc/img/ico-msg/ico-ok.gif) no-repeat center center;}
.ico-btn-order-close{background: url(//web2.yystatic.com/project/noble/pc/img/ico-msg/ico-cancel.gif) no-repeat center center;}*/


/*ť*/
.btn-order{cursor:pointer;margin-right:4px;}
.btn-order ul,.btn-order li{float:left;}
.btn-order .left-normal, .btn-order .right-normal, .btn-order .left-over, .btn-order .right-over{width:3px;height:22px;}
.btn-order .middle-normal, .btn-order .middle-over{height:22px;_height:18px;line-height:22px;text-align:center;padding-left:8px;padding-right:8px;_padding-top:4px;white-space:nowrap;display:block;}
.btn-order .middle-over a{text-decoration: none;}
.btn-order .middle-normal img, .btn-order .middle-over img{margin-right:5px;} 
/*ť״̬*/
.btn-order .left-normal{background:url(//earn.yystatic.com/earn/images/bg-msg/bg-btn-lr.gif) no-repeat 0 0;}
.btn-order .middle-normal{background:url(//earn.yystatic.com/earn/images/bg-msg/bg-btn-middle.gif) repeat-x 0 0;}
.btn-order .right-normal{background:url(//earn.yystatic.com/earn/images/bg-msg/bg-btn-lr.gif) no-repeat 0 -22px;}
.btn-order .left-over{background:url(//earn.yystatic.com/earn/images/bg-msg/bg-btn-lr.gif) no-repeat 0 -44px;}
.btn-order .middle-over{background: url(//earn.yystatic.com/earn/images/bg-msg/bg-btn-middle.gif) repeat-x 0 -22px;}
.btn-order .right-over{background:url(//earn.yystatic.com/earn/images/bg-msg/bg-btn-lr.gif) no-repeat 0 -66px;}
/*mark*/
.mask{z-index:20013;position:absolute;top:0;left:0;-moz-opacity:0.5;opacity:.50;filter:alpha(opacity=50);background-color:#000;width:100%;height:100%;zoom:1;}
.mask iframe{position:absolute; z-index: -1; }

/* 弹出框start */
.msg-window-ico-prompt, .msg-window-ico-error, .msg-window-ico-success, .msg-window-ico-warning, .msg-window-ico-pay{width:15px;height:48px;float:left;display:inline; background:none; margin:0;}

.pop_box{width:400px;height:auto;display:block;position:absolute;text-align:center;overflow:hidden; z-index:999;}
.pop_box li,.pop_small li,.pop_special li,.pop_long li,.pop_508 li,.pop_show_box li,.pop_card_box li,.pop_sign_box li{ font-size:12px;}
.pop_title{ width:400px; height:31px;background:url(//web2.yystatic.com/project/noble/pc/img/entertain/pop_title_bg.gif?v=20120531) no-repeat;}
.pop_title_left{width:100%; height:31px;}
.pop_title_right{ width:100%;height:31px;}
.pop_title_midle{ background:url(//web2.yystatic.com/project/noble/pc/img/entertain/pop_title_icon.gif?v=20120531) scroll 10px 7px no-repeat; height:31px; line-height:31px; font-size:12px; color:#fff; padding:0 0 0 30px;position:relative; text-align:left;}

.pop_box a.pop_close{ position:absolute; right:1px; top:1px; background:url(//web.yystatic.com/project/noble/pc/img/entertain/pop_close.gif?v=20120531) scroll 0 0 no-repeat; width:43px; height:20px; overflow:hidden; outline:none; cursor:pointer;}
.pop_box a.pop_close:hover{ background:url(//web.yystatic.com/project/noble/pc/img/entertain/pop_close.gif?v=20120531) scroll 0 -20px no-repeat;}
.pop_content{ width:400px;text-align:left;  color:#333; font-size:12px;}
.pop_content p{line-height:20px;}

.pop_btn{ background:url(//web2.yystatic.com/project/noble/pc/img/entertain/btn_bg.gif?v=20120531) no-repeat scroll 0 -38px; height:24px; width:70px; overflow:hidden; cursor:pointer; line-height:24px; text-align:center; color:#333; border:none;font-size:12px;border:1px solid #9ABED8;border-radius:3px;}
.ico-btn-long{display:inline-block;width:100px; height:24px; line-height:24px; text-align:center; color:#333; border:none; background:url(//web2.yystatic.com/project/noble/pc/img/entertain/btn_bg.gif?v=20120531) scroll 0 -62px; overflow:hidden; font-size:12px; cursor:pointer;}
